Virginia Outdoors Plan

The Virginia Outdoors Plan is the Virginia’s comprehensive plan for land conservation, outdoor recreation, and open-space planning. The document helps all levels of government and the private sector meet needs pertaining to those matters. The plan is required for Virginia … Continued
